House votes to extend individual tax cuts
The House on Friday voted to permanently extend the individual tax cuts in President Trump’s 2017 tax law, giving House Republicans a chance to tout the law as they prepare to leave Washington to campaign.
The legislation passed on a vote of 220-191. Three Democrats voted for the legislation and ten Republicans voted against it.
